Trinidad ⁣and Tobago Faces Escalating Violence Prompting ​State of Emergency Declaration

In a‌ dramatic move‍ to curb escalating violence,the government of Trinidad and Tobago has ⁤declared a state ⁣of emergency following a weekend marked by‌ unrest and alarming crime rates. The decision comes⁤ in response‌ to a spate of⁣ violent incidents that​ have left communities shaken and urged citizens to ⁤demand ⁤action.⁢ Authorities are ⁢implementing strict measures including:

  • Increased police presence: Law enforcement agencies are mobilizing additional personnel to patrol ‍high-risk areas.
  • Nighttime curfews: Residents ⁤will ​face restrictions‍ on ⁣movement during certain hours to ​enhance public safety.
  • Community engagement programs: Measures aimed at fostering dialog between⁤ law enforcement and ⁢local communities are being ‌prioritized.

As ​the state of⁢ emergency unfolds,⁢ officials are focusing on addressing​ the root ⁢causes of violence, including socio-economic disparities and youth ‌disenfranchisement.Recent ‌reports indicate a surge in gang-related activities and firearm offenses, prompting serious concerns among citizens‌ and ⁣international observers alike. The government is also considering a ​special legislative session to‌ discuss ‍potential reforms aimed at reinvigorating public trust in safety institutions.

Analysis of ‌Recent ​Violence⁣ and Its impacts on Public Safety and Security

The recent surge of violence in Trinidad and tobago has prompted a nationwide state of emergency, raising urgent⁣ questions regarding the impacts ⁣on‌ public safety and security.Law enforcement ⁤agencies are tasked with navigating⁢ the ⁢complex landscape‌ of crime‌ and unrest, while communities are grappling with ‌heightened⁤ fear and​ uncertainty. Key‍ factors contributing to the spike in violence include:

  • Gang Activity: ⁢Increased‌ territorial disputes among gangs have led to escalated ⁢confrontations.
  • Social Discontent: ​Economic challenges and​ rising unemployment amplify frustrations, often resulting ⁤in violent outbursts.
  • Poor Community Resources: Lack​ of access to essential services contributes ⁢to a cycle of‌ crime and instability.

The response from authorities aims⁤ to ​restore order, but it also underscores the‍ broader implications for societal trust and engagement.
